GNOME configuration database system (system defaults service)
GConf is a configuration database system for storing application preferences. It supports default or mandatory settings set by the administrator, and changes to the database are instantly applied to all running applications. It is written for the GNOME desktop but doesn't require it.
This package contains the PolicyKit service that allows to edit the system-wide defaults from a user session.
